Kim Rae-Won & Park Hoon are cast in SBS drama series “Full Count.” The drama series will be the first baseball themed series shown on SBS since “Hot Stove League” in 2019. Story for “Full Count,” will depict a power struggle between two coaches who want to become the permanent manager for their baseball team Stars. Kim Rae-Won will play Hwang Jin-Ho. He was a backup catcher during his playing career and now works as the Stars batting coach. Park Hoon will play Jo Dong-Hee. He was a heralded pitcher for the Stars and now is a pitching coach for them team.
“Full Count” will first air sometime next year in South Korea.
Plot Synopsis by AsianWiki: Hwang Jin-Ho (Kim Rae-Won) used to be a catcher, who spent most of his playing career as a backup. He now works as a batting coach for the popular baseball club Stars. Even though he is well regarded as a coach, he has been an outsider within the club’s exclusive atmosphere. He takes the acting manager position for the Stars while they are on the brink of elimination from the playoffs. The job is seen like a poisoned chalice.
Meanwhile, Jo Dong-Hee (Park Hoon) used to be a legendary pitcher for the Stars and he is now a pitching coach for the team. Despite his brilliant career as a pitcher, he is haunted by never winning a championship during his playing career. As a coach, he aims to lead the Stars to a championship. He also wants to become the manager for the Stars.
Hwang Jin-Ho and Jo Dong-Hee fight fiercely for the team on the baseball field and an intense power struggle takes place in the dugout and clubhouse.
